Impacts of Synthetic Laundry Detergents on Aquatic Ecosystems
Synthetic laundry detergents are often composed of surfactants, phosphates, and enzymes that pose serious risks to aquatic ecosystems. These chemicals can lead to a variety of harmful effects on aquatic species. For example, surfactants can disrupt water's surface tension, making it difficult for fish and other marine organisms to swim and feed effectively. Furthermore, the presence of phosphates can trigger eutrophication, resulting in harmful algal blooms that deplete oxygen levels in water, creating dead zones where fish and aquatic life struggle to survive.
- Surfactants disrupt water's surface tension, impacting fish movement and feeding behavior.
- Phosphates contribute significantly to eutrophication, causing harmful algal blooms that diminish oxygen levels in water.
Understanding the Impacts of Natural Laundry Detergents
Natural laundry detergents are predominantly derived from plant-based ingredients, typically free from phosphates and harsh synthetic surfactants. However, it is vital to recognize that some natural components can still impact aquatic life negatively. For instance, certain plant extracts may become toxic in large quantities, and even biodegradable materials can lead to water pollution if not adequately treated in wastewater systems. Therefore, while natural detergents may reduce some environmental risks associated with synthetic products, careful evaluation of their ingredients and disposal methods remains necessary.
- Natural detergents are often less harmful but can still disrupt sensitive aquatic ecosystems.
- Biodegradable does not mean completely safe; some natural ingredients may pose toxicity risks.
